I wanted a small truck that was quiet, comfortable, and capable. After 25 years with a GMC Sierra 1500, I've already hauled all the big loads of rocks, trees, lumber, etc. that go with building a new home on a good sized piece of land. And with 296K miles at 17mpg, it was time to send that beautiful old workhorse to the Great Truckstop in the Sky.

Couldn't see shelling out $55K to $120K for a full-sized replacement, but I still need a truck for smaller, maintenance-related jobs and for COSTCO runs and trips to the nursery. I learned long ago that you can easily cut your A/C use significantly by manipulating air flow in the cab. So, I ordered my '25 Lariat Hybrid with the works...moon roof, power rear window, and slim profile deflectors on all four windows. And I got a prescription from my doctor to tint the glass as protection from skin cancer. The setup provides endless options for directing fresh air without engaging the A/C and that helps keep me up between 40mph and 50mph for the frequent 10 mile runs around the local area.

We're exactly halfway between S.F. and L.A., two cesspools we prefer to stay away from. But when duty calls. I can run the freeway either north or south to one of those concrete slag heaps and count on getting 35mph to 38mpg and that's enough to put a smile of my mug and leave some serious cabbage in my wallet.

BTW, I got the 4K tow, 360 cameras, Blackout package, factory bed liner, and every other bell and whistle Ford offers on this little beauty. The high-end build cost over $10K less than the stripped down, base model of a full-sized p/u truck. So far, I've put nearly 9K trouble-free miles on it and am hoping to get about 200K more. FYI due to fraudulent diy paper plates!!!
Dealers are deputized and have metal plates in stock!!!!
Elimination of Paper Tags: Effective July 1, 2025, Texas motor vehicle dealers will no longer issue:
Buyer Tags
Internet Down Tags
Vehicle Specific Tags
Agent Specific Tags
Instead of issuing Buyer Tags, beginning July 1, 2025, dealers will issue metal plates to vehicle purchasers at the time of sale. Unless another type is warranted by the vehicle type or use, dealers will issue the general issue license plates registered with the county on behalf of the buyer. More information will be provided in separate communications to dealers about their plate allocations and distribution of plates for this purpose. Beginning July 1, 2025, the eTAG system will no longer be available to dealers.
